Sexual Isolation
A mechanism of evolutionary divergence where different species or populations can no longer interbreed due to behavioral or genetic barriers.
Gametic Isolation
A prezygotic barrier where gametes (egg and sperm) of different species are incompatible, preventing fertilization.
Mechanical Isolation
A form of reproductive barrier where differences in the size and shape of reproductive organs prevent mating between species.
Sympatric Speciation
The evolution of a new species within the same geographic region as the parental species. Compare with allopatric speciation.
